A New Dog Leash That Promises to Revolutionize the Standard Lead

Launching their new product and website, Suki's Lead promises to give dog owners more options with their dog.

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E

 
 
sukisFaceLogoSmall
sukisFaceLogoSmall
PRLog (Press Release) - Mar. 17, 2012 - It has long been known that dog companions bring happiness and better health to their owners, potentially even lengthening their lives.  More and more people are taking their dogs around town with them.  Every year more cities are giving more freedoms to dogs, establishing designated off-leash play areas in the form of parks and beaches.  Recently, Los Angeles went so far as to allow dogs to be with their owners in outdoor seating areas.  Previously, they had to be tied up away from other customers.  

As a long time dog owner, Enzia Farrell saw the need for a new dog leash that lets dogs more easily travel with their owners, and so Suki's lead was created to fill the void.  “The standard 6 ft. or retractable leashes cannot be easily tied around objects. The knot is clumsy and often takes up too much of the leashes length and sometime requires the owner to detach their dog from the leash in order to slip its length through its handle in order to fix it around an object,” explains Enzia.  “I found it terribly frustrating.”  

And so her leash was born of frustration necessity.  Designed to be able to clip to or around almost anything without detaching the dog from the leash, it increases an owner’s control and options.  Since it can be clipped to be shorter or in various loop combinations, it can go from regular 6 ft. length to a traffic lead to a temporary tie-out without hassle or uncontrolled moments.  It can even be clipped around her waste ot to her belt loop when her dog is off-leash. Noticing that she never picked up a standard leash or a retractable again, she knew she was onto something and invested in creating this product for the public.  

“I hope to make it easier to bring dogs around town.  If owners can do errands with their dogs, they get things done and stimulate their dogs at the same time.  Why not take their dog to the cafe, get some coffee, stop by the corner store, or post office with the family dog?  It helps all involved be a bit healthier, plus it might save a favorite pair of shoes from being chewed up out of boredom.”

Enzia Farrell, goes to as many places as possible with Suki, her French Bulldog and inspiration.  She believes doing so creates not only a good relationship with her dog, but keeps her well socialized and well stimulated.  "Suki loves going shopping with me," she explains.  "While she needs a lot of exercise, she also needs mental stimulation."
